Shirasu, the generic name for the juvenile offspring of various fish, is an ingredient found in Japan's spring and early summer seasons.
Kamawanu furoshiki are dyed using a special hand-printing technique that allows the print to soak into the fabric so that the design can be enjoyed from both sides. This results in unique furoshiki that cannot be found anywhere else.
The “Oishii Furoshiki” series features playful designs based on familiar foodstuffs. The approximately 50 cm square, 100% cotton material is lightweight and durable. It is the perfect size for wrapping bandanas and small items.
